American Bald Eagle

The national bird of the United States and a symbol of American conservation success, bald eagles have a wingspan of up to 2.4 meters and inhabit forests and wetlands near open water across North America. Powerful aerial predators and scavengers, they specialize in fish but also take waterfowl and carrion. Nearly extinct by the 1960s due to DDT poisoning and hunting, the bald eagle recovered dramatically following pesticide bans and the Endangered Species Act.

Ciboria batschiana is a saprotrophic cup fungus in the family Sclerotiniaceae, distributed across temperate Europe and parts of western Asia. It is one of the more frequently recorded members of the genus and typically fruits in autumn on fallen acorns and mast of oak (Quercus) species, occasionally also on beechnuts and other hard mast. The fruiting bodies are small, stalked discs with a concave to flat spore-bearing surface, ranging from pale buff to chestnut brown, and reaching up to about one centimeter across. The stalk arises from a sclerotium—a compact mass of fungal tissue within the decomposing nut—which enables the fungus to persist through unfavorable conditions. Ciboria batschiana plays a role in the decomposition of hard mast in woodland leaf litter and is categorized as Least Concern. The species is widespread but rarely abundant, and tends to be locally distributed depending on mast production years. It is associated with mature oak and beech woodland across its range. Taxonomic placement within Sclerotiniaceae has been confirmed by molecular studies. As with many small discomycetes, accurate identification requires microscopy to examine spore dimensions, paraphysis morphology, and the character of the excipular tissue. The species name honors the eighteenth-century naturalist August Johann Georg Karl Batsch.
